Common Bathroom Shower Renovation Jobs
Shower enclosure upgrades - replacing or installing new glass enclosures for a modern look.
Tile and grout replacement - updating shower walls with durable, stylish tile options.
Shower pan installation - ensuring a watertight base for a leak-free shower.
Custom shower remodeling - redesigning shower layouts to maximize space and functionality.
Accessibility upgrades - adding features like grab bars and walk-in entries for safety and convenience.
Waterproofing solutions - applying sealants and membranes to prevent water damage and mold growth.
Bathroom Shower Renovation Questions
What types of shower renovations are available? Renovations can include replacing tiles, upgrading fixtures, installing new shower enclosures, or adding custom features to improve style and functionality.
Can existing shower spaces be expanded or reconfigured? Yes, some projects involve enlarging the shower area or changing its layout to better suit the space and homeowner preferences.
What materials are commonly used for shower renovations? Popular options include ceramic, porcelain, natural stone tiles, acrylic, and glass for enclosures and fixtures.
Is it possible to update a shower without a full renovation? Yes, minor updates like new fixtures, re-grouting, or adding shelves can refresh a shower’s appearance without a complete overhaul.
